Latest Patents
Stickney holds a patent for a receptacle runner assembly. This assembly includes a pair of opposed sub-assemblies that are arranged in a spaced relationship at opposite sides of the receptacle. Each sub-assembly features a runner that is designed to move along a first track in a specific direction. The assembly also includes a first linkage that connects the receptacle and the runner, along with a bearing that is secured relative to the receptacle. The design allows for the displacement of the receptacle in a direction perpendicular to the first direction while the runners are in motion. This innovative approach enhances the functionality and efficiency of receptacle assemblies.
